- 1、本文档共27页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
内容分发系统中副本放置算法的设计与实现汇报人:2024-01-14
引言内容分发系统概述副本放置算法的设计与实现副本放置算法的性能评估副本放置算法的优化和改进结论与展望
01引言
研究背景和意义互联网内容爆炸式增长随着互联网技术的快速发展,网络上的内容呈现爆炸式增长,如何有效地管理和分发这些内容成为了一个重要的问题。提高内容分发效率通过设计合理的副本放置算法,可以在保证内容可用性的同时,提高内容分发的效率,降低网络拥塞和延迟。提升用户体验优化副本放置策略可以减少用户获取内容的等待时间和网络带宽消耗,从而提升用户体验。
国内外研究现状尽管已经有很多关于副本放置算法的研究,但是在实际应用中仍然存在着一些问题和挑战,如动态网络环境、用户行为的不确定性等。存在的问题和挑战国内外学者已经提出了许多经典的副本放置算法,如最小连接数算法、轮询算法、哈希算法等。经典副本放置算法近年来,随着机器学习技术的不断发展,一些基于机器学习的副本放置算法也逐渐被提出和应用。基于机器学习的副本放置算法
研究内容本文旨在设计并实现一种高效的内容分发系统中副本放置算法,以提高内容分发效率和用户体验。研究方法首先,对现有的副本放置算法进行深入研究和分析;其次,基于机器学习和优化理论设计新的副本放置算法;最后,通过仿真实验和实际应用验证算法的有效性和性能。研究内容和方法
02内容分发系统概述
内容分发系统(ContentDeliverySystem,CDS)是一种基于网络的技术和服务,用于将数字内容(如网页、视频、音频、应用程序等)快速、高效、安全地传输给用户。定义内容分发系统通常包括源服务器、内容缓存服务器、负载均衡器、请求路由器等组件。源服务器存储原始内容,内容缓存服务器存储内容的副本,负载均衡器分配用户请求,请求路由器将用户请求路由到最近的缓存服务器。架构内容分发系统的定义和架构
关键技术内容分发系统的关键技术包括内容缓存技术、负载均衡技术、请求路由技术、内容复制技术等。这些技术可以提高系统的性能、可用性和可扩展性。挑战内容分发系统面临的挑战包括网络延迟、带宽限制、安全性问题、内容更新同步问题等。这些挑战需要通过优化算法、改进协议、增强安全性等方法来解决。内容分发系统的关键技术和挑战
边缘计算随着边缘计算技术的发展,内容分发系统将更加注重边缘节点的利用,通过在用户设备附近部署缓存服务器,减少网络传输延迟,提高用户体验。多媒体内容支持随着多媒体内容的不断增加,内容分发系统需要支持更高质量、更多样化的多媒体内容传输,如4K/8K视频、VR/AR内容等。安全性增强保障用户隐私和数据安全是内容分发系统的重要发展趋势。系统将采用更强大的加密技术和访问控制机制,确保内容的机密性、完整性和可用性。智能化利用人工智能和机器学习技术,内容分发系统可以实现自适应的内容缓存和请求路由,根据用户行为和网络状况动态调整策略,提高系统的性能和效率。内容分发系统的发展趋势
03副本放置算法的设计与实现
副本放置算法的原理和分类原理副本放置算法是内容分发系统中的关键组成部分,其目标是将内容副本放置在合适的位置,以最小化用户请求延迟、最大化系统吞吐量和提高资源利用率。分类根据不同的设计目标和实现方式,副本放置算法可分为基于流行度、基于地理位置和基于机器学习等多种类型。
基于流行度的副本放置算法通过分析历史数据,预测内容的未来流行度,将流行度高的内容放置在离用户更近的位置。流行度预测当缓存空间不足时,需要设计合适的缓存替换策略,如LRU(LeastRecentlyUsed)或LFU(LeastFrequentlyUsed),以决定哪些内容应该被替换。缓存替换策略
通过获取用户的地理位置信息,将内容副本放置在离用户更近的位置,以减少网络传输延迟。用户位置感知考虑网络拓扑结构,将内容副本放置在关键的网络节点上,以优化数据传输路径和减少网络拥塞。网络拓扑感知基于地理位置的副本放置算法
数据驱动利用机器学习技术,从历史数据中学习内容的访问模式和用户行为,以更准确地预测未来的内容需求。个性化推荐结合用户画像和个性化推荐技术,为用户提供定制化的内容推荐和副本放置策略,提高用户体验和满意度。基于机器学习的副本放置算法
04副本放置算法的性能评估
一致性评估数据在多个副本之间的一致性程度。可用性系统在面对故障时的表现,如容错能力和恢复时间。负载均衡评估各节点间的负载分布情况,避免某些节点过载。延迟测量从请求发出到接收到响应的时间,包括网络延迟和处理延迟。吞吐量单位时间内成功处理的请求数量,反映系统的整体性能。评估指标和方法
VS描述实验所使用的硬件和软件环境,包括网络拓扑、节点配置、操作系统、编程语言等。数据集说明实验所采用的数据集,包括数据来源、数据规模、数据特征等。实验环境实验环境和数
文档评论(0)